Skip to content

Conversation

@merll
Copy link
Contributor

@merll merll commented Sep 26, 2025

📌 Summary

This is a follow-up to #2453, as it turned out that ArgoCD might take a while to synchronize the Application fully. This can lead to a long or permanent unavailability of the endpoint, if other pre- or post-upgrade actions fail. The necessary action has been changed to a pre-upgrade script, and also been narrowed to the change that ArgoCD will not do by itself, i.e. removing the annotation from the Ingress object.

🔍 Reviewer Notes

🧹 Checklist

  • Code is readable, maintainable, and robust.
  • Unit tests added/updated

@merll merll marked this pull request as ready for review September 26, 2025 13:40
@merll merll merged commit d76e5d3 into main Oct 3, 2025
12 checks passed
@merll merll deleted the APL-566-followup branch October 3, 2025 11:56
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ants